45. Carlyle isn't a defense contractor per se
They're a privately held investment group that buys controlling interests in lots of different kinds of companies. The issue with that they have invested in defense contractors and they've had George Bush Sr., James Baker, and other people of influence with legislators who vote on appropriations for defense contracts. The Carlyle Group in and of itself wouldn't be a problem if it weren't for all the GOP ex-cabinet members, etc. that are willing to be extremely well paid lobbyists. Since The Carlyle Group is privately held, they aren't under the same scrutiny that a publicly held company would be. Of course there's nothing keeping these officials from being stockholders in Carlyle either.
